
French niche line Anatole Lebreton has launched Tabaquero, a new fragrance.
A splash of liquerous rum bathes a spicy accord of fenugreek and smoky tobacco, full of character. Amber and licorice crackle amidst the swirls of balsam and vanilla. The Tabaquero is the Latin American healer who identifies, soothes, and relieves the aches and pains of body and mind using tobacco, a plant considered sacred. A powerful, visceral fragrance that penetrates the senses and stirs the spirit.
**
I envisioned Tabaquero as a shamanic journey. The tobacco, the spices, the smoke… I sought a fragrance that was spiritual, yet also deeply physical. We are not in a gentle meditation, but rather in an intense trance.
Additional notes include cinnamon, cypriol, cade, benzoin and immortelle.
Anatole Lebreton Tabaquero is available in 50 ml Eau de Parfum.
